Dear Working Wise:I’ve been looking for a job for three months now, but I haven’t found anything. I don’t want to sit at home, I want to work.Do you have any suggestions? Signed, Want to Work

Dear Working Wise:

Working WiseWorking WiseWorking Wise

Dear Want to Work:

There are a number of services available to help you �nd a job, including:• 53 Alberta Works Centres located across the province: humanservices.alberta.-ca/o�ces• Dozens of job fairs in communities across the province: humanservices.alberta.ca/-jobfairs• The Career Information Hotline: 1-800-661-3753 (780-422-4266 in Edmonton)• The ALIS careers web site: alis.alberta.ca

These services can help you connect with employers who are hiring, access free job-search workshops, and pick up innovative new job-search ideas. One idea that you might not have tried yet is networking. The ALIS website o�ers two tip sheets and a video on using networking to �nd unadvertised jobs. Networking is one of the most e�ective ways to �nd work—more than 60 per cent of jobs are �lled by people who heard about them through networking.

And networking is simple: 1. Contact people you know.2. Tell them about the kind of job you are looking for and your quali�cations.3. Ask them if they know of any jobs or can refer you to someone who might.

ALIS networking tips:• Networking is not asking someone for a job—it’s gathering information and making connections to new people who know about unadvertised opportunities. • Networking is a two-way street—be prepared to give as much information and support as you receive.• Networking works because most people want to be helpful and trust referrals from people they know.• Not everyone feels comfortable networking at �rst. If you are nervous, start with the people you know best, like friends, family and former coworkers or classmates. Networking is a skill: you will get better at it with practice. • Expand your network by participating in work- or profession-related social media channels like LinkedIn and attending profes-sional association or union functions.• Carry business cards with your name, credentials, phone number and e-mail address. • When you call or e-mail referrals, tell them who referred you. Keep the conversation short and always thank them for their help.If they don’t have the information you need, ask them if they know someone who might.

At formal networking events: • Bring lots of business cards with you and hand them out freely.• Say hi to people you know, but keep it brief. You’re there to meet new people. • Approach people with con�dence, a smile and a �rm handshake. Introduce yourself, explain your occupation and talk brie�y about your experience.• Ask people for their business cards and ask if you can follow up. Contact them within a few days. Ask a question about their �eld or o�er them some information. Tell them about your work search and ask if they know of any opportunities or can refer you to someone who might.

For more tips on job searches and networking, search the alis.alberta.ca website.

Good luck!
